Ukraine Corn Export Prices Surge Amidst Increased Demand

Ukraine Corn Export Prices Surge Amidst Increased Demand

Recent developments in Ukraine's corn market indicate a notable uptick in export prices fueled by heightened demand and active market dynamics. Traders are adjusting prices to accommodate increased sales activity while navigating various factors impacting the market.

Price Movement and Market Trends

Purchase prices for corn in Ukraine have risen by $3-4/t this week, reaching $162-166/t or UAH 7,200-7,400/t with delivery to Black Sea ports. This increase is attributed to robust April exports and significant sales anticipated for May. Traders are strategically adjusting prices by reducing margins and minimizing freight and port handling costs.

Farmer Behavior and Sales Outlook

With farmers primarily focused on sowing activities, sales have been restrained as they await potentially higher prices. However, an uptick in offers is expected within the coming week, potentially impacting market dynamics.

Export Projections and Market Dynamics

In the 2023/24 FY, Ukraine exported 22.9 million tons of corn, slightly below the USDA's projected 24.5 million tons. April saw exports of 4.14 million tons, with further exports of 2.5-3 million tons expected in May. However, traders may need to pay a premium to secure these volumes amidst market conditions.

Impact of External Factors

A recent 3.5% decrease in oil prices is anticipated to exert pressure on corn prices, particularly amidst increased offers from Argentina. Additionally, July corn futures on the Chicago Mercantile Exchange experienced fluctuations, rising by 0.9% to $177.5/t, driven by higher ethanol production.

US Planting and Production Trends

Ethanol production in the US saw an increase after a 3-week decline, reaching 987,000 barrels/day. Corn usage for ethanol production in March surged by 7.48% compared to the previous year, signaling robust demand. Planting progress in the US stands at 27% of planned acreage, with favorable weather conditions expected to accelerate planting.

Argentinian Harvest Forecast

In Argentina, corn harvesting progress stands at 20% of the area, with varying yield conditions reported across regions. Despite challenges such as diseases and pests impacting yield in certain areas, the Buenos Aires Grain Exchange maintains its corn harvest forecast for 2023/24.
